1: Utilize Under-Bed Storage Bins for Extra Space
Under-bed storage represents one of the most underutilized spaces in any home, offering a smart solution for hidden storage ideas that maximize available square footage. By strategically selecting storage bins designed to slide seamlessly beneath your bed frame, you can transform this typically ignored area into an organized and efficient storage zone.
According to research from Texas Tech University, vertical storage systems near bedframes can significantly improve space optimization and object safety. This principle applies perfectly to under-bed storage strategies.
When selecting under-bed storage bins, consider these key factors:
-
Measurements matter: Ensure bins are slightly smaller than the bed’s clearance to guarantee smooth sliding
-
Material durability: Choose bins made from robust plastic or fabric with reinforced bottoms
-
Lid design: Select containers with secure, dust-resistant lids to protect stored items
Under-bed storage works exceptionally well for seasonal clothing, extra bedding, rarely used sports equipment, and personal memorabilia. Clear plastic bins with labels make identifying contents quick and easy, preventing unnecessary rummaging.

4: Maximize Closet Doors with Over-the-Door Organizers
Over-the-door organizers represent an ingenious hidden storage solution that transforms unused vertical space into a functional storage powerhouse. These slim, adaptable systems convert seemingly wasted door surfaces into highly efficient organizational zones without requiring additional floor or wall space.
Home organization experts recognize over-the-door organizers as strategic storage solutions that can dramatically increase storage capacity in bedrooms, bathrooms, pantries, and utility areas. By leveraging vertical space, these organizers create additional storage opportunities in areas previously considered unproductive.
When selecting over-the-door storage systems, consider these essential factors:
-
Material durability: Choose organizers made from robust materials like reinforced mesh or heavy-duty plastics
-
Weight capacity: Verify the organizer can safely support intended items
-
Attachment mechanism: Ensure compatible mounting hardware for different door types
Different rooms demand specialized over-the-door solutions. Bedroom doors can accommodate accessories and jewelry organizers. Bathroom doors work perfectly with towel racks and toiletry holders. Pantry doors become ideal locations for spice racks, cleaning supply holders, and lightweight kitchen tools.
Installation requires minimal effort. Most over-the-door systems feature hook-based designs that do not require permanent modifications to doors or walls. This no-damage approach makes them ideal for renters and homeowners seeking flexible storage options.

6: Create Hidden Storage in Stairs or Steps
Stairs represent one of the most underutilized spaces in modern homes, offering an extraordinary opportunity for ingenious hidden storage solutions. By transforming each step into a potential storage compartment, homeowners can reclaim valuable square footage that would otherwise remain unused and overlooked.
According to architectural research on innovative storage designs, staircase storage can dramatically increase a home’s organizational capacity without compromising aesthetic appeal. These clever design interventions turn seemingly mundane architectural elements into functional storage zones.
When considering stair storage options, evaluate these critical design factors:
-
Structural integrity: Ensure modifications do not compromise stair stability
-
Weight distribution: Design drawers that can safely support intended items
-
Accessibility: Create smooth sliding mechanisms for easy retrieval
Hidden stair storage works brilliantly across multiple scenarios. Entryways benefit from shoe storage compartments built directly into stair risers. Home offices can utilize step drawers for storing documents and office supplies. Family rooms might incorporate media equipment or board game storage within carefully crafted stair compartments.
The most successful stair storage solutions blend seamlessly with existing architectural design. Matching wood tones, installing discrete drawer pulls, and maintaining clean lines ensure these hidden spaces look intentional rather than retrofitted. Precision engineering transforms each step into a secret storage opportunity that enhances both form and function.
